BoJack Horseman - Season 1

Season 1
Once the star of the hit sitcom "Horsin' Around," today BoJack's washed up, just hanging around Hollywood complaining, and wearing colorful sweaters.

Episodes

The BoJack Horseman Story, Chapter One
To help with the memoir he hopes will put him back in the spotllight, BoJack hires a ghostwriter.

BoJack Hates the Troops
BoJack finds himself the subject of national media attention after he calls the troops ''jerks''.

Prickly-Muffin
BoJack reconnects with a friend from his past who moves into his house and creates pandemonium.

Zoës and Zeldas
BoJack decides to mentor Todd; Diane's ex-boyfriend writes an article about Mr. Peanutbutter.

Live Fast, Diane Nguyen
A business trip for BoJack and Diana takes a detour; Todd runs a scam that gets him in trouble.

Our A-Story Is a 'D' Story
BoJack is jealous of Diane's relationship wtih Mr. Peanutbutter; Todd's in a new environment.

Say Anything
BoJack sabotages himself with an epic bender; Princess Carolyn's agency merges with another.

The Telescope
When he learns that his old friend from ''Horsin' Around'' is dying, BoJack tries to mend fences.

Horse Majeure
A lovestruck BoJack tries to sabotage a wedding; Todd accepts a surprising new professional role.

One Trick Pony
BoJack shoots a movie at Mr. Peanutbutter's house; Diane finishes her book.

Downer Ending
BoJack embarks on a project in his typically gonzo style, leading to a drug-fueled revelation.

Later
Months after his memoir is released, BoJack's being considered for a role that's a lifelong dream.

Chopped
Chopped is a cooking competition show that is all about skill, speed and ingenuity. Each week, four chefs compete before a panel of expert judges and turn baskets of mystery ingredients into an extraordinary three-course meal. Course by course, the chefs will be "chopped" from the competition until only one winner remains. The challenge? They have seconds to plan and 30 minutes to cook an amazing course with the basket of mystery ingredients given to them moments before the clock starts ticking! And the pressure doesn't stop there. Once they've completed their dish, they've got to survive the Chopping Block where our three judges are waiting to be wowed and not shy about voicing their culinary criticisms! Our host, Ted Allen, leads this high-energy, high-pressure show that will have viewers rooting for a winner and cheering for the losers. Chopped is a game of passion, expertise and skill — and in the end, only one chef will survive the Chopping Block. Who will make the cut? The answer is on Chopped!
